Task
To write this letter, some important aspects must be observed. Do not forget to write:
Greeting
Dear Mr./Ms. Last Name: (Use a formal salutation, not a first name, unless you know the person extremely well. If you do not know the person's gender, you can write out their full name. For instance, you could write "Dear Pat Crody" instead of "Dear Mr. Crody" or "Dear Ms. Crody."
Body of Letter
The first paragraph of your letter should provide an introduction as to why you are writing so that your purpose is obvious from the very beginning.
Then, in the following paragraphs, provide more information, mention the impact the article you've read had on you, whether you agree / disagree
conclusion
the last paragraph you can make some suggestions for a next article and thank the reader for reading your letter
